Childhood and youth
Werberg was born on June 10, 1963 in Moscow. The girl's parents were far from the sphere of art. Father Arnold Yakovlevich served as a pilot in his youth, and after the collapse of the Union he became a businessman. Mother Galina Georgievna held a position at an enterprise that produces military equipment for space. But their daughter, in her youth, became interested in theater and wanted to become an actress.
After graduating from school, the girl tried to enter theatrical universities. For two years in a row, the applicant was unlucky, and on the third, luck unexpectedly smiled at her: Victoria managed to pass exams at several educational institutions at once. She was even invited to his course at the Moscow Art Theater School by Oleg Efremov himself. However, the young Muscovite chose to study at GITIS.
Personal life
The performer does not make a secret of her personal life, talking about her in an interview. It is known that Maxim Vitorgan became Verberg's chosen one. Despite the fact that the young man was 9 years younger than the actress, this age difference did not bother the spouses living in a civil marriage. The couple met in the early 90s, when Victoria and Maxim worked together at the Moscow Youth Theater.
At that time, the woman started repairs in the apartment and needed a man who performed construction work. Vitorgan Jr. offered his help, so communication began. And soon the actors began to live together. The lady was passionately in love with "a tall, handsome man with green eyes," as she herself described her husband. When it became known that the artist was expecting a child, Werberg was sure that the boy would be the first.
The performer even chose the name Philip for her first child. When a girl was born in July 1996, Victoria remembered how the little son of her friends, even before the pregnancy of the actress, asked to give birth to a bride named Polina. So the name for the daughter was chosen. In September 2000, an addition happened in the family - the actors became Daniel's parents.
Over time, passion left the relationship of the spouses, they decided to leave. After the divorce, Maxim and Victoria remained on good terms, tried to ensure that the children were not traumatized by the events taking place. Vitorgan Jr. had a new family, and his first wife chose to remain free.
Theater and films
In 1986, after graduating from GITIS, the performer received an invitation from her teacher Anatoly Efros to play at the Taganka Theater. The girl gladly accepted the offer, but the director died before Verberg had time to draw up documents for work in the troupe. According to the Muscovite, the departure of the master was a big blow for her. It seemed that life had lost its meaning, and an acting career would have to be put an end to.
Soon the artist was offered to cooperate with the Moscow Youth Theater. At first, the idea of playing in a children's theater did not seem tempting to Vika. However, the wife of her teacher Efros, Natalya Krymova, convinced the girl that work here would be a good basis for a further theatrical career. The actress listened to the advice and did not regret it: her whole life was connected with this place.
Victoria Verberg now
In 2020, several films with the participation of Victoria Arnoldovna were released. So, the woman played the role of Nosova, the chief accountant in the series "Magomaev". Also, the public appreciated the game of the lady in the film "Ice-2". Here the artist got used to the colorful image of the head teacher.
